The Graco Ultra Cordless Airless Handheld Paint Sprayer 17M363 is a lightweight and portable paint sprayer powered by DEWALT XR Lithium Ion batteries, allowing for convenient cordless use and mobility, especially useful for ceiling painting. It features a Triax triple piston pump with RAC X FFLP spray tips that provide a smooth, airless finish without the need to thin paint, delivering good coverage and professional results at various speeds.
Weighing about 1 pound, this sprayer is easy to handle overhead and helps reduce arm fatigue during ceiling projects. It has a small 0.25-gallon tank, so refilling may be necessary more frequently during larger jobs. The unit offers powerful pressure up to 2000 PSI, providing strong spraying capability.
Designed for durability with a stainless steel build and full repairability, the sprayer is well-suited for small to medium ceiling tasks. Its portability and ability to produce a smooth finish without paint thinning make it an attractive choice, though longer spraying sessions and extended reach may require considering models with larger tanks and hoses.
The Graco 17G180 Magnum ProX19 Cart Paint Sprayer is a powerful, professional-grade choice that works well for ceiling painting, especially in large or multi-story homes. It offers fully adjustable pressure, letting you control paint flow precisely, which is great for different paint thicknesses and project sizes. The spray tip system includes a RAC IV SwitchTip that you can reverse to clear clogs quickly, reducing interruptions. With its stainless steel piston pump, it can spray paint straight from a bucket without thinning, saving prep time. The sprayer supports up to 150 feet of hose, giving you the extra reach needed for ceilings without constantly moving the unit. Cleaning is straightforward thanks to a PowerFlush Adapter that connects to a garden hose, speeding up maintenance.
The sprayer is quite heavy at 42 pounds, which might make moving it around somewhat challenging for one person. While it comes with a large 5-gallon tank capacity, this model is more suited for bigger jobs or frequent use rather than small, occasional projects. Its one-year warranty covers manufacturer defects but not wear and tear from heavy use.
If you're tackling extensive ceiling painting or rental properties where durability and ease of use matter, this sprayer delivers strong performance with fewer clogs and easy cleanup. For lighter, occasional ceiling jobs, its size and weight might feel bulky and more than needed.
The Graco Magnum 262800 X5 Stand Airless Paint Sprayer is well-suited for homeowners and remodelers who need a powerful and mobile tool for larger projects. Its airless design and fully adjustable pressure control make it versatile for spraying both paints and stains without needing to thin them. This feature is particularly useful for achieving a smooth finish on ceilings. The sprayer comes with a flexible suction tube that can draw paint directly from 1 or 5-gallon buckets, which adds convenience and reduces the need for frequent refills during large projects.
Additionally, the sprayer supports up to 75 feet of hose, allowing you to reach high or difficult-to-access areas like second-story ceilings without losing performance, making it ideal for extensive house painting tasks. The unit is relatively lightweight at 17 pounds, which, combined with its 12.4-inch width and 17.9-inch height, enhances its portability and ease of use. The stainless steel material ensures durability, and the 3000 PSI maximum pressure provides ample power for most home projects.
However, the product’s weight might still be a challenge for some users over extended periods of use. Cleaning the sprayer after use can be somewhat tedious, though the ease of cleaning is generally considered manageable by most users. The sprayer comes with a one-year warranty against manufacturer defects, which provides some peace of mind. Despite these strengths, the Graco Magnum X5 might be overkill for very small projects or for users who only need a sprayer occasionally.
